Mr. Speaker, I want to give the members two specific examples of how municipalities are in fact handling the infrastructure program. When I was in one community in my riding not so long ago, I was told: "Well, we are going to look after our sewers on the main street". The councillor admitted to me that this work would be done next year but they were pushing it ahead one year because the infrastructure program was there.
A second community in my riding, and these are communities that have no reason to tell me other than the truth, said they were going to modify their beautiful ice arena equipment so that it would be upgraded, work they would do simply two years down the road.
My comment is that I do not believe that many of the things that are being done with the infrastructure program should be done with borrowed money. I would be more than willing to have the member's comment on that.
